luxflux/cloudbalancer

View on GitHub
Branch: master(View all)
NameLines of codeMaintainabilityTest coverage
.gitignore
.rspec
.ruby-gemset
.ruby-version
.travis.yml
Gemfile
Gemfile.lock
Readme.markdown
bin/cloudbalancer
bin/cloudbalancer-loadbalancer
bin/cloudbalancer-node
bin/cloudbalancer-node2
bin/echo_server.rb16
bin/echo_server2.rb16
bin/lvs-wrr.rb46
lib/cloud_balancer.rb11
lib/cloud_balancer/cli.rb14
lib/cloud_balancer/cli/status.rb56
lib/cloud_balancer/config.rb3
lib/cloud_balancer/load_balancer.rb130
B
4 hrs
lib/cloud_balancer/load_balancer/algorithms.rb6
lib/cloud_balancer/load_balancer/algorithms/wrr.rb41
A
45 mins
lib/cloud_balancer/load_balancer/find_name_mixin.rb9
lib/cloud_balancer/load_balancer/service.rb13
A
45 mins
lib/cloud_balancer/load_balancer/service_node.rb18
A
35 mins
lib/cloud_balancer/load_balancer/service_nodes.rb21
lib/cloud_balancer/load_balancer/services.rb5
lib/cloud_balancer/load_balancer/tcp_client.rb10
lib/cloud_balancer/load_balancer/tcp_server.rb31
lib/cloud_balancer/load_balancer/to_json_mixin.rb12
lib/cloud_balancer/logger.rb9
lib/cloud_balancer/node.rb60
lib/cloud_balancer/node/checks.rb7
lib/cloud_balancer/node/checks/load.rb20
lib/cloud_balancer/runner.rb17
lib/cloud_balancer/status.rb25
lib/cloud_balancer/transport.rb6
lib/cloud_balancer/transport/amqp.rb76